Practice set – 4.2
(1) Construct a tangent to a circle p and radius 3.2 cm at any point M on it.
Solution:
Circle of radius 3.2 CM
Here, line l is the tangent of circle with centre p and radius 3.2 cm. Touching the circle at point M.
Steps to construct:
(1) Draw a circle of given radius.
(2) Take any point on circle and draw a ray from centre through that point.
(3) Draw a line perpendicular to the ray going through the point on the circle .
(4) The line is the desired tangent.

(6) Draw a circle with centre P and radius 3.4 cm. Take point Q at a distance 5.5 cm from the centre. Construct tangents to the circle from point Q.
Solution:
Circle of radius 3.4 cm with P as Centre.
Q is a point outside the circle 5.5 cm from point P
M&N arc the point on tangent QM & QN respectively when it touches the circle.
Steps of construction:
(1) Constract a circle of given radius with centre p.
(2) Take a point on the exterior of given length from the centre.
(3) Draw segment PQ.
(4) Draw a perpendicular bisector of PQ.
(5) Draw a circle with radius PR when R is the midpoint of PQ and centre R.
(6) The point where the new circle use the tangent touching points.
(7) Now joint the two point with the exterior point Q to get the two tangents.
